Output 6b75543ffda5cb3b79d3cba780f0c2d64d1f0023c701442bd0124ddc473ed35a:0

value
797503093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c02e973c58cd83d656110b4c7e7d4f7beb0ba9 OP_EQUAL
address
3KdLbBVGsjdWZEEjo5BCD57zmX4UsDExFs
transaction
6b75543ffda5cb3b79d3cba780f0c2d64d1f0023c701442bd0124ddc473ed35a
spent
true